Mansion House Inn And Spa
"We absolutely loved our stay at Mansion House Inn & Spa. This was our first trip to MV, and we didn't really know where we should stay, but we are so happy we ended up staying in Vineyard Haven, and specifically at Mansion House. The Inn is so beautifully decorated, the location is super convenient, and I honestly don't think I have ever stayed at a place that is so clean. Everything is pristine - including the stairwells! The beds are super comfortable, and the linens are all top notch. Everyone was so helpful, and really wanted to help us put together the best weekend. We followed all of their tips, and just had such a memorable long weekend there. We loved the low-key vibe of Vineyard Haven. It was fun to go to Oak Bluffs and Edgartown, but we really appreciated coming back to the more relaxed feel of Vineyard Haven. We greatly enjoyed the shops and the restaurants that were just steps from the hotel. We also enjoyed an amazing couples massage at the spa. We unfortunately did not make it up to the rooftop deck until the last day. The view up there is phenomenal and it would have been great to enjoy my morning coffee up there. On the last day, upon recommendation of the hotel staff, we took the free island bus to Aquinnah. The views there are absolutely spectacular. Thank you to all of the staff at Mansion Inn for helping us enjoy such a memorable time on MV!"
